From: Martin Michlmayr <tbm@xxxxxxxxxx>

commit 0899638688f223fd9e9fee60d662665e11693d12 upstream.

include/scsi/osd_protocol.h uses ALIGN() without an #include
<linux/kernel.h>, leading to:
| include/scsi/osd_protocol.h:362: error: implicit declaration of function 'ALIGN'
